The elimination of B&rtlett culls
from future cannery sales was dis
cussed by the Rogue River Valley
Traffic association at its weekly
luncheon-meeting at the Hotel Hoi
'.and Thursday. No definite actK n was
taken but plans were made for fur
ther consideration.
It was brought out that elimina
tion of culls would raise the price of
prime pears. The meeting was in
formed that about one-quarter of the
Bartletts canned in California Inst
-cason were culls.
It was stated that if the canneries
were compelled to take only quality
264.04 pears it would not be necessary to
263.50 Ship so many to the fresh fruit re
tail markets and therefore a better
price structure could be maintained
all the way around.
R. W. Gray, representative of the
24.40 California fresh deciduous tree fruit i
nn rn ' m3retnS agreement, was present as
1 335 "ft a Buest of the association and dls-1
541,49 cussed the cull situation.
l!tt7!:t) ' Jflcle Spalding informed the asso
ciation that there would be a. meet
ing of the Oregon -Washington Pear
league In Portland Saturday to sign
the pear subsidy agreement Just re
ceived from the United States de
partment of agriculture. , Under tn
agreement the government Is to pay
a subsidy on winter pears diverted
to out-of -channel domestic and spe
clflfTd foreign markets.
In the absence of Earl Newbry,
Harry Rosenberg, a past president,
presided at today's session.
Girl Can Retain
Engagement Ring
PORTLAND, Ore., Oct. 30. (AP)
Whatever remained of E. R. Smart's
summer romance probably departed
when he was denied recovery of gifts
lavished upon a fair lady.
Smart, resident of The Dalles, lost
a suit In District Judge George Nor
rls Wood ley's court against Mrs Elm
Roemer, to whom he said he one
was engaged. He sought to regain
possession of three diamond rings
one he said was the engagement to
ken and other gifts valued at 9230.
The Judge said even though one
of the rings was an engagement ring
there was nothing In the law to re
quire Its return.
